Anthony Joshua (16-0, 16 KOs) landed the IBF World Heavyweight title with a brutal second round KO win over Charles Martin at The O2, live on Saturday, April 9.
In front of a sold-out crowd, Joshua began with his trademark blistering speed and power in the opening round, rocking the unbeaten champion with solid shots.
However, after demolishing the reigning titleholder “Prince” Charles Martin in two rounds on Saturday night, Joshua said, “I am not going to get too carried away because there’s a lot of work to be done. I have to keep on improving because I have people like David Haye calling me out, Tyson Fury calling me out, all of them. I need to keep on pushing if I’m going to maintain at a high level. He said:
“Every Heavyweight has got power but it’s about speed and precision, locking in and staying focused. A few months ago I was in here with Dillian Whyte having a great scrap that was one for the fans, this was one for myself. I told you I was going to come out and punish him, I told you I would show him levels and this is the reward of it,”
